### Seat-map renderer: review steps

Stagelight renders the Pemberly Hall seat map from a cached layout blob. If seats appear shifted, invalidate the layout cache, not the pricing cache. Verify row-letter mapping against the venue fixture before approving. Zoom artifacts above 2x are a known canvas issue; don't block on them. Confirm the diff was produced against the renderer build token below.

session token of bagag-fafop = htk21_cbc501024a787b9031ac6

Ticket: Staging env misconfigured for Siftgate bloom filter

The bloom layer in front of the Pellet KV store is rejecting all lookups in staging because the env file was copied from the dev template without credentials. False-positive tuning values are fine; only the auth line is missing. To unblock the weekly demo, the Pellet admission secret must be set on the following line.

env line for yaguf-fajop: LEDGER_TOKEN13=fb08984397349

## Releases

Hey on-call — the Framepress transcoding farm ships on a weekly cadence, Thursdays. Workers pull the new encoder image automatically, but only if the manifest is signed. If a rollout stalls, check the signer step first; nine times out of ten someone forgot it. Don't hand-patch nodes in the Oakhollow cluster, it just makes drift. To sign the manifest yourself in a pinch, use the key below.

signing key of bagap-yawep = bky13_TbfT6ZMUoGJo2

## Deployment

Heads up: Wrenfold enforces per-tenant rate quotas at the gateway, so a bad deploy here can throttle every customer at once. The quota maps are baked into the release artifact — no hot edits, sorry. If a big tenant starts getting 429s after a rollout, check whether the new build shipped with stale quota values before you touch anything else. Roll back first, debug second. For reference, the values every healthy production node should be running with are listed below.

deployment values, yadug-bawif:
[framir]
team = pelox
access_code = ac_a38ab2
owner = tamion.julael
host = framir.tolvaqlabs.test
port = 11211
peer = tammir.zemvargrid.local
salt = 2215ef03
pin = 1541